How Laser Hair Removal Works :

It uses the laser in a sterile environment by a trained technician to quickly and efficiently remove unwanted hair gently from problem areas. Laser focuses a beam of light at a wavelength that hones in on dark colors on the skin. This picks up on the hair dye, even if you're blonde hair appear as dark spots on the laser. The laser inside the device by hand, which then uses art to target these areas of unwanted hair, and transportation to the affected area that are addressed and the process to remove unwanted hair. Laser hair removal procedure works best for individuals with fair colored skin and dark hair. Because hair grows in cycles, it is recommended that all types of skin and hair to undergo several treatments for minimse the risk of damage and to maximize the effectiveness of laser hair therapy. Not all your hair is ready to remove such different stages of growth in all parts of the body even additional therapies would be best to catch the hair in the growth phase and a good technician will be able to evaluate poetry and the stage of what is in it.
